Abstract

Drawing on ethnographic fieldwork with a rich network of community-supported Islamic and Quranic schools in the state of Kano in northern Nigeria, this paper shows how making school curricula responsive to local value systems and economic opportunities is key to building a strong sense of community ownership of schools.
